Motor Repair
Most Hesperia motor repairs fall in the $180–$450 range — control board diagnostics, limit-switch adjustment, gear replacement, or arm rebuild. The desert’s hard on these units: windblown abrasive sand packs into operator housings, corroding bearings and stripping gears, while summer heat degrades capacitors and winter freezes crack hydraulic seals. We open the housing, assess whether repair makes sense versus replacement, and give you an honest number. If the motor’s been fighting a bent frame or loose post, we’ll spot that too — fixing the motor without fixing the load is just burning money.

Slide Motor Service
Slide gate operators generally outlast swing operators in Hesperia’s wind — the gate stays on its track instead of acting like a sail. Installation runs $1,100–$2,200; repairs $220–$520. We see a lot of slide motors on the longer driveways in 92345’s semi-rural reaches, where ranch-style properties need 16–20 feet of clearance secured. Chain-drive and rack-and-pinion systems both have their place; Nicholas will tell you straight which suits your gate’s weight, cycle count, and exposure to Victor Valley’s 50+ mph gusts.
Battery Backup Installation
Battery backup isn’t optional in Hesperia — it’s survival. Power outages during Santa Ana wind events are common, and a gate that won’t open manually because the operator’s seized means you’re either trapped or unsecured. Battery backup installation runs $340–$580 depending on operator compatibility and battery capacity. We spec cold-weather battery kits; standard batteries lose 30–40% capacity in hard-freeze conditions, and January’s when you’ll need it most.

Common Gate Motor & Opener Problems We See in Hesperia Homes
- Freeze-induced operator seizure. Hesperia’s 1990s–2000s building boom installed automatic gate operators that were not spec’d for hard-freeze conditions, so a gate “stopped working in January” is usually a hydraulic or battery-backup operator that failed during the first hard frost — a failure mode almost unheard of in Palmdale or Victorville. We diagnose whether it’s a thaw-and-repair situation or time for cold-rated replacement.
- Sand-packed bearing and gear corrosion. Victor Valley’s persistent windblown abrasive sand infiltrates operator housings, grinding down bearings and stripping gears far faster than in cleaner climates. We see this on Hesperia gates that “sound fine but won’t move” — the motor runs, but the drivetrain’s destroyed inside.
- Wind-load motor burnout. Santa Ana gusts and Mojave channel winds exceeding 50 mph physically strain gate frames, forcing continuous-duty motors to overwork and eventually fail. The motor isn’t the root problem — the bent frame or loose post is — and we fix both, not just swap the motor to watch it burn again.
- UV-degraded control enclosures and wiring. Hesperia’s intense high-desert UV cracks plastic housings and brittles wire insulation within a few years, leading to intermittent failures that mimic control-board problems. We inspect the whole electrical path, not just throw parts at symptoms.
Pricing for Gate Motor & Opener in Hesperia, CA
| Service | Typical Range in Hesperia |
|---|---|
| Diagnostic & minor repair (limit switch, remote programming, safety sensor alignment) | $180–$280 |
| Moderate repair (gear replacement, control board, arm rebuild) | $280–$450 |
| Major repair / motor replacement (existing gate, retrofit) | $650–$1,200 |
| New operator installation (swing gate, standard duty) | $850–$1,600 |
| New operator installation (slide gate, heavy duty / high wind) | $1,100–$2,400 |
| Battery backup add-on | $340–$580 |
| Intercom integration with existing operator | $420–$780 |
What moves you within these ranges: gate size and weight, operator brand and age, whether the gate frame and posts are sound, and how accessible your electrical supply is. A 20-year-old operator on a sagging gate in 92345’s ranch country takes more labor than a clean swap on a newer install in the Main Street corridor. Twice yearly — once before summer heat peaks, once before first hard freeze. The sand, UV, and temperature swing in Hesperia accelerate wear beyond what annual service handles. A quick inspection and lubrication catches bearing corrosion, gear wear, and enclosure leaks before they strand you. We offer maintenance plans; ask when you call.
